Hyperliquid Trader Loracle Faces $30M Loss on HYPE Short Position
A prominent trader on Hyperliquid, identified as Loracle, has incurred significant losses amounting to $30 million on a short position involving the HYPE token, which recently achieved record highs. The scenario, detailed by Crypto Adventure, highlights the position's scale at roughly 1.83 million HYPE with considerable leverage.

A prominent trader on the Hyperliquid exchange, known as Loracle, faces a loss of around $30 million due to a short position on the HYPE token. HYPE recently surged to record highs, reaching approximately $61 to $62. Loracle's short position includes about 1.83 million HYPE, utilizing 5x leverage with an average entry point around the mid-$40s.
This situation illustrates the risks associated with high-leverage trading, particularly as market volatility increases. The surge in HYPE's value could reflect broader trends in the memecoin space, where speculative trading can lead to rapid price fluctuations. Traders must be cautious, especially when utilizing leverage in a volatile market.
Looking ahead, market participants may monitor Loracle’s actions and any potential market corrections in response to HYPE's price movements. The implications of this loss could also lead to shifts in trading strategies among other investors in the memecoin sector.
